The bill amends Minnesota Statutes 2024, specifically section 201.091, to modify the information requirements for public information lists related to registered voters. It removes the requirement to include the "year" of voting history and replaces it with the term "date." Additionally, it specifies that a public information list must not include a voter's date of birth, Social Security number, driver's license number, identification card number, military identification card number, or passport number. The bill also emphasizes that individuals inspecting the public information list must provide identification and a written statement confirming that the information will not be used for purposes unrelated to elections, political activities, or law enforcement.

Furthermore, the bill establishes that the county auditor must withhold a voter's name from the public information list if the voter provides a signed statement indicating that withholding their name is necessary for their safety or that of their family. It also outlines restrictions on the use of the public information list, prohibiting the publication of any information from the list on the Internet and the sale or loan of the information to any person or entity, with certain exceptions for organizations or political subdivisions. The effective date for these changes is set for the day following final enactment.
